2ちゃんねる スマホ用 ■掲示板に戻る■ 全部 1- 最新50    

■ このスレッドは過去ログ倉庫に格納されています

スレを勃てるまでもないC/C++の質問はここで 23

728 :デフォルトの名無しさん:2015/09/19(土) 22:00:51.68 ID:ppmJVZuM.net
エンディアンについて疑問というか不安なのですが
エンディアンはソフトを使う側のCPUに依存するのでしょうか?
もしそうだとすると、ソフトの設定をファイルに保存する時にパラメータをまとめた構造体を fwite() で保存して、
そのファイルを他のPCに移動させると、エンディアンが違っていたら誤った値がロードされるのでしょうか?

対策としては2バイト以上の値をすべて1バイトに分解して自分で順番を決めてファイルに書き込むしかないのでしょうか?
readmeに「マシンを超えて設定ファイルを移動させるな」と書くのは最終手段でなるべく避けたいです

総レス数 1027
279 KB
新着レスの表示

掲示板に戻る 全部 前100 次100 最新50
read.cgi ver 2014.07.20.01.SC 2014/07/20 D ★